Overview of LCMXO3L-9400E-6BG256I – MachXO3 Field Programmable Gate Array, 9,400 logic elements, 206 I/Os

The LCMXO3L-9400E-6BG256I is a MachXO3 family FPGA offering a mid-range programmable logic fabric with 9,400 logic elements and a high I/O count. Designed for system control, I/O consolidation and embedded logic functions, the device delivers on-chip memory, flexible I/O and family-level configuration and clocking features.

This surface-mount, industrial-grade device is supplied in a 256-ball LFBGA package and supports a core voltage range of 1.14 V to 1.26 V and an operating temperature range of -40 °C to 100 °C.

Key Features

  • Core Logic  Approximately 9,400 logic elements for implementing control, glue logic and custom state machines.
  • On-chip Memory  Approximately 0.42 Mbits (442,368 bits) of embedded RAM for buffering, small FIFOs and register storage.
  • I/O Capacity  206 user I/Os to support peripheral interfacing, bus bridging and signal aggregation.
  • Power and Temperature  Low-voltage core operation with a recommended supply range of 1.14 V to 1.26 V and an industrial operating temperature range of -40 °C to 100 °C.
  • Packaging and Mounting  256-LFBGA (supplier package: 256-CABGA 14×14) in a surface-mount form factor for compact board designs.
  • Non-volatile Configuration and Reconfiguration  MachXO3 family features include non-volatile, multi-time programmable configuration and TransFR reconfiguration capabilities described in the family datasheet.
  • Integrated System IP and Clocking  Family-level documentation highlights embedded hardened IP (I2C, SPI, timer/counter), on-chip oscillator and flexible on-chip clocking including PLLs.
  • Regulatory  RoHS-compliant manufacturing status.

Typical Applications

  • Industrial Control  Industrial-grade temperature range and robust I/O count make the device suitable for control logic, I/O expansion and interface management in industrial systems.
  • Embedded System Glue Logic  Use as a central glue-logic device to consolidate peripheral interfaces and implement custom finite-state machines with on-chip RAM for small buffers and FIFOs.
  • Peripheral Bridging and I/O Aggregation  High I/O density enables aggregation and protocol bridging between multiple low- to mid-speed peripherals and system buses.
